1.Effect of epidural puncture combined with dual epidural block on labor analgesia and on maternal blood pressure and fetal umbilical arteriovenous blood gas in pregnancy-induced hypertension
Jiaying XIN ; Xuebo BAI ; Zhaoguo LI
Chinese Journal of Postgraduates of Medicine 2025;48(4):373-378
Objective:To explore the effect of dural puncture epidural (DPE) combined with dual tube epidural block in labor analgesia of hypertensive women with pregnancy and its impact on fetal umbilical arteriovenous blood gas.Methods:A total of 120 pregnant women with gestational hypertension who underwent vaginal delivery from February to August 2023 in the Affiliated Hospital of Jining Medical College were prospectively selected and divided into two groups by random number table method, with 60 cases in each group. The observation group was given DPE combined with double epidural block for analgesia, and the control group was given double epidural block for analgesia. Blood pressure level, Digital Pain Rating Scale (NRS) score, analgesia quality and efficiency, anesthesia level, adverse reactions and fetal umbilical arteriovenous blood gas analysis were compared between the two groups before and after injection.Results:The systolic blood pressure and diastolic blood pressure in the two groups were significantly decreased at 15 min, 30 min, 1 h and 2 h after injection, and the systolic blood pressure and diastolic blood pressure in the observation group were lower than those in the control group at the above time points, there were statistical differences ( P<0.05). The NRS scores at 30 min, 1 h and 2 h after injection in the observation group were lower than those in the control group: (3.30 ± 0.25) scores vs. (4.91 ± 0.28) scores, (2.18 ± 0.37) scores vs. (3.25 ± 0.43) scores, (1.76 ± 0.21) scores vs. (2.44 ± 0.22) scores, there were statistical differences ( P<0.05). The time required for T 10 to reach the anesthetic plane in the observation group was shorter than that in the control group: (9.10 ± 1.35) min vs. (13.25 ± 1.64) min, there was statistical difference ( P<0.05). The dosage of analgesic drugs (sufentanil), the proportion of the highest sensory anesthesia plane to T 6, and the proportion of the lowest sensory anesthesia plane to S 4 between the two groups had no statistical differences ( P>0.05). The onset time of analgesia in the observation group was shorter than that in the control group: (12.34 ± 3.45) min vs. (17.13 ± 3.57) min, and the number of relief analgesia was lower than that in the control group: (1.74 ± 0.32) times vs. (2.09 ± 0.45) times, there were statistical differences ( P<0.05). The incidence of adverse reactions between the two groups had no statistical differences ( P>0.05). The pH value, partial pressure of arterial oxygen, partial pressure of arterial carbon dioxide and residual alkali between the two groups had no statistical differences ( P>0.05). Conclusions:DPE combined with double tube epidural block has a significant effect on labor analgesia in pregnant women with hypertension, which can effectively improve the efficiency and quality of analgesia, relieve maternal pain. In addition, the combined therapy has little impact on the stablity of blood pressure, and fetal umbilical arteriovenous blood gas, which hardly generate adverse events and deserved for clinical promotion.
2.Analysis of suicide methods and demographic characteristics of attempted suicide patients in Baise City
Jiaying LI ; Xinyu BAI ; Yourong CAO ; Qianwei HUANG ; PHILLIPS Michael R ; Zhenyu MA
Chinese Mental Health Journal 2025;39(10):849-855
Objective:To analyze suicide methods and demographic characteristics of attempted suicide pa-tients in Baise City,Guangxi and to provide the basis for suicide intervention.Methods:A retrospective analysis method was conducted on the case data of attempted suicide patients treated in the emergency departments of 14 general hospitals in Baise City from 2018 to 2021.The situation of attempted suicide patients was recorded using the suicide patient information collection forms.Results:Among the 2 529 attempted suicide patients,1 636 committed-suicide by taking pesticides,557 used therapeutic drugs,112 used rodenticides,and 53 used carbonmonoxide(CO).The proportion of male and farmer suicides by taking pesticides was higher,and the proportion of female and non-farmer suicides by taking therapeutic drugs was higher.Multivariate analysis showed that the proportion of patients aged 45-60 years old patients who took pesticide was higher(OR=3.18),while the proportion of patients aged 45~60 who took therapeutic drugs was lower(OR=0.19).The proportion of suicides taking pesticides and using carbon monoxide significantly decreased in 2020(OR=0.56)and 2021(OR=0.52),while the proportion of sui-cides taking therapeutic drugs significantly increased in 2020(OR=2.04)and 2021(OR=3.18).Conclusion:Proportion of attempted suicide by taking pesticides is the most common method of suicide among residents in Baise City,with males,farmers,and middle-aged groups being the most affected.The proportion of attempted suicide by taking medication has significantly increased,with a higher incidence among women.
3.Real world clinical data analysis of fuzuloparib for the treatment of ovarian epithelial cancer patients
Danhui WENG ; Jie JIANG ; Yingjie YANG ; Mingqian LU ; Jiaying BAI ; Ming LIU ; Xiaoling LI ; Jun TIAN ; Yutao GUAN ; Quan LI ; Liang CHEN ; Qiubo LYU ; Lixia MA ; Yali WANG ; Huicheng XU ; Hailong GUO ; Li SUN ; Ding MA ; Qinglei GAO
Chinese Journal of Obstetrics and Gynecology 2025;60(8):590-599
Objective:To evaluate the safety and effectiveness of fuzuloparib for the treatment of ovarian epithelial cancer patients in the real world setting.Methods:A retrospective analysis was conducted on the baseline data of 4 620 ovarian cancer patients who had received fuzuloparib monotherapy or combination therapy. Another 224 ovarian cancer patients who were willing to receive fuzuloparib monotherapy or combination therapy were prospectively enrolled, and their baseline characteristics, drug effectiveness, and safety data were analyzed.Results:(1) Among the 4 620 patients in the retrospective cohort, the median age of patients was 60 years; tumor types: 89.8% (4 149/4 620) had ovarian cancer. Among patients with clearly documented information, the vast majority had a histological type of serous carcinoma (82.9%, 3 770/4 546) and International Federation of Gynecology and Obstetrics (FIGO) staging of Ⅲ-Ⅳ (90.9%, 1 537/1 691). (2) Among the 224 patients in the prospective cohort, the median age of patients was 57 years; tumor types: 83.9% (188/224) had ovarian cancer. Among patients with clearly documented records, the predominant pathologic type was serous carcinoma (91.9%, 193/210), and FIGO stage was Ⅲ-Ⅳ in 79.9% (139/174). (3) Among the 224 prospective patients: 84 patients received first-line fluzoparib maintenance therapy, 92 patients received fluzoparib maintenance therapy after platinum-sensitive recurrence, 23 patients received direct fluzoparib treatment after platinum-sensitive recurrence, 19 patients received direct fluzoparib treatment after platinum-resistant recurrence. The median follow-up durations were 8.5, 8.7, 7.9, and 6.7 months, respectively. The median durations of fluzoparib treatment were 6.7, 4.8, 3.1, and 1.9 months, respectively. The median progression-free survival (PFS) times were not reached during follow-up, 12.6 months, not reached during follow-up, and 4.8 months, respectively. The 1-year PFS rates were 84.1%, 55.0%, 69.8%, and 45.5%, respectively. The remaining 6 patients received other fluzoparib regimens. (4) Among the 224 patients in the prospective dataset, 205 had safety data recorded. Of these, 127 patients (62.0%, 127/205) experienced treatment-related adverse events, with common events including anemia (24.4%, 50/205), thrombocytopenia (21.0%, 43/205), and leukopenia (19.5%, 40/205). Among the 205 patients, 43 (21.0%, 43/205) experienced grade 3 or higher treatment-related adverse events, with common events including anemia (8.3%, 17/205) and thrombocytopenia (8.3%, 17/205).Conclusions:The effectiveness of fuzuloparib in clinical application is generally consistent with other drugs in the same class, with good safety. This study provids new clinical evidence for the treatment of ovarian cancer with fuzuloparib.
4.Panoramic and local histological observations of biotinylated dextran amine neural tracer labeling in the motor cortex of rat brain
Jiaying LU ; Dongsheng XU ; Jingjing CUI ; Yuqing WANG ; Yuxin SU ; Yihan LIU ; Jia WANG ; Wanzhu BAI
Journal of Capital Medical University 2025;46(1):83-90
Objective To reveal the detailed histological characteristics of pyramidal neuron cell bodies and their axonal projections along the corticospinal tract in the primary motor cortex(M1)of the brain,by using the biotinylated dextran amine(BDA)neural tracing technique combined with panoramic and local microscopic imaging technologies.Methods A total of 100 nL of 10%BDA(10,000 molecular weight)was injected into M1 region using stereotaxic system.The distribution of BDA labeling along the corticospinal tract was continuously tracked with panoramic tissue scanning analysis system.Detailed observations of the histological characteristics of BDA labeling were carried out with laser confocal microscope.Results It is more convenient to observe the overall distribution of BDA neural labeling by using the panoramic tissue scanning analysis system.Around the injection site in M1,the BDA labeling was shown in the somas of pyramidal neurons in layer V.In the M1 region corresponding to the contralateral site of the injection site and ipsilateral primary sensory cortex,BDA showed predominantly the anterograde labeled nerve fibers accompanied by a few retrograde labeled neurons.Besides,BDA labeled nerve fibers-including bundles and terminals-projecting to regions such as the ipsilateral striatum,thalamus,internal capsule,cerebral peduncle,and pons,and further reaching the contralateral spinal cord via the brainstem pyramidal decussation.Confocal microscopy and its 3D reconstruction system facilitated detailed analysis of the local microscopic features of BDA labeling,revealing retrograde labeled neuron cell bodies,dendrites and their spines,as well as anterograde labeled nerve fibers and their terminals.Conclusions These findings demonstrated that the integration of traditional BDA neural tracing with panoramic tissue scanning analysis and confocal microscopy provided an effective approach to the observation and analysis of long-projection neural circuits from panoramic to local perspectives,with broad application prospects.
5.Correlation Between Cortical Thickness and Putamenial Dopamine Transporter in Parkinson's Disease
Jing WANG ; Jingjie GE ; Xia BAI ; Ping WU ; Yuhua ZHU ; Jiaying LU ; Huamei LIN ; Huiwei ZHANG ; Zhengwei ZHANG ; Chuantao ZUO
Chinese Journal of Medical Imaging 2025;33(3):280-285
Purpose To investigate the cortical thickness features in Parkinson's disease(PD)patients at various stages and their association with dopamine transporter(DAT)levels in the putamen.Materials and Methods We retrospectively enrolled 30 PD patients and 15 healthy subject who underwent 11C-CFT PET and T1 MRI scans at the Department of Nuclear Medicine/PET Center of Huashan Hospital from August 2016 to October 2020.DAT average radioactivity in the anterior and posterior putamen was analysis using SPM12 software,with the occipital lobe as the reference region.Cortical segmentation and reconstruction were performed on T1 images using Freesurfer v7.2.The differences in cortical thinning between the groups were compared using a general linear model.Additionally,the relationship between cortical thickness in various brain regions and DAT uptake in the putamen were assessed.Results Compared to healthy subjects,significant cortical thinning was observed in the left inferior parietal lobule and the right and left inferior middle frontal gyrus of PD patients(all P<0.05).There was a significant positive correlation between the cortical thickness of the left inferior parietal lobule and right inferior middle frontal gyrus and DAT uptake in the corresponding anterior/posterior parts of the putamen(r=0.30-0.47,all P<0.05).Furthermore,the DAT uptake in the right precentral gyrus was positively correlated with the ipsilateral posterior putamen,exhibiting a stronger correlation than on the contralateral side(r=0.32,P=0.029).Conclusion The results show that the thickness of the thinning cortex area in the PD patients correlates significantly positively with DAT levels in the putamen,highlighting the importance of the basal ganglia cortical circuit and providing a basis for further research into the neural mechanisms of PD.
